Ethnomusicology Multimedia (EM) is a collaborative publishing initiative of Indiana University Press and Temple University Press with the support of the Andrew W. Mellon Foundation for first books in ethnomusicology accompanied by a web-based platform for audio and video materials. Ethnomusicology Multimedia seeks to enhance the value of scholarly books in ethnomusicology by linking fieldwork audiovisual materials to the written text, thus providing a unique interactive experience for readers.
